3
The most important feature of the seating is the comfortability and the easiness as one has to sit for approximately 2 hours to watch the full length movie. The seats should possess wide armrests to maintain the right balance and the sliding footrest should extend before as the backrest reclines. This will help in giving the support to the body.
There should be a proper stability and flexibility at the seat and back, and the seat should possess high density foam cushions in order to offer extreme comfort and back support. The seats should be capable of providing support from head to toe. Therefore, only those seats should be selected that are fully comfortable in each and every manner so that it should become relaxing and entertaining to watching film.

Home theatre furniture has also been slashing their prices to make it more affordable for people to purchase sets. Single or Double Chairs can now be bought for prices a bit over 200 dollars and there are some 4 seat sets that cost just over a thousand dollars. Most of this home theatre furniture has their own set of recliners, huge arm rests with great cup holders.
The feel of a home theatre is never complete without home theatre furniture. Big leather sets that recline along with their self contained TV trays, huge arm rests and cup holders almost makes one feel like they are on a first class section of an airplane, which for the most part can be true since the subcontractors for such seats are often the ones that do make the home theatre furniture. Again, it is the economies of scale as making more of such seats enables the manufacturer to bring down their prices.
